    A winter storm warning is in effect for western Massachusetts

    CHICOPEE, Mass. (WWLP) – A winter storm warning was issued Saturday afternoon through early Monday morning due to heavy snow with accumulations of 5 to 12 inches in parts of Massachusetts.

    Temperatures on Saturday at 7 a.m. will be in the teens and low to 20s. If we see any sun on Saturday, it will disappear very quickly! The weather will be cloudy most of the day, with a light breeze from the east. High temperatures will be in the low to mid 30s.

    We expect snow to start falling between 5pm and 8pm. The snow will be heaviest from 10pm on Saturday until 3am on Sunday.

    Light to moderate snow is expected to fall continuously on Sunday morning. Snowfall will taper off Sunday shortly after noon and end before 7 p.m. Everyone will get a “tillable” backlog. High temperatures on Sunday will be in the lower 30s.

    Saturday: cloudy. Snow arrives 5-8 p.m
    Heights: 32-36
    Wind: E 5-10 mph

    Saturday night: Snow, sometimes heavy, after 10 p.m.
    Lowest levels: 24-30

    Sunday: Morning Snow. Light snow/winds in the evening. Snow ends from 4pm to 7pm
    Heights: 30-34

    Monday: sunny

    Elevations: 36-40
